Leaked Page
ThePornDude
Likes
Log In
Home
/
Fansly
/
sinasukie_vr
/
776065284774572032
sinasukie_vr
Final part from the carfuck (look the trailer what is insite)
Published: May 6th 2025, 9:12:22 am
Like Post
Previous
Next
Final part from the carfuck (look the trailer what is insite)
Previous
Next